Pirates RHP Jared Jones to undergo elbow surgery

Pittsburgh Pirates right-hander Jared Jones will undergo surgery on his right elbow Wednesday and is expected to miss the remainder of the season, the club’s senior director of sport medicine Todd Tomczyk announced.
Jones, who was slated to be the team’s No. 2 starter this season, has been on the injury list with a UCL sprain in his right elbow. His recovery was trending in the right direction before a setback last week
Jones, 23, went 6-8 with a 4.14 ERA in 22 starts last season in his rookie campaign.
